Is your Hunter Rain Click Sensor activating signals when it shouldn't? Or perhaps it's malfunctioning at all? Don't fret, these common issues can often be solved with a few simple troubleshooting steps.

First, inspect the sensor for any visible problems. This includes the lens, wiring connections, and support bracket. Ensure the sensor is properly installed to a stable surface and not obstructed by debris or vegetation.

Next, examine the connections. Make sure they are tightened properly at both the sensor and the controller. Incorrect wiring can lead to communication problems between the two units.

If you've inspected the sensor and wiring, but it's still not working, there might be a problem with the controller itself or the signal transmission. In these cases, it's best to look at your controller's manual for specific troubleshooting instructions or get in touch Hunter Customer Support for assistance.

Common Problems and Solutions for Hunter Rain Click Sensors

Hunter Rain Click sensors are a popular choice for automatic irrigation systems due to their reliability and ease of use. However, like any electronic device, they can sometimes encounter problems. Some typical issues include false activations, sensor stoppage, and communication problems with the irrigation controller.

If your Rain Click sensor is activating unnecessarily, it could be due to debris obstructing the sensor. Cleaning these obstructions can often resolve the issue. Another possibility is that the device itself is defective, in which case it may need to be exchanged.

Connectivity problems can occur if the sensor's power source is low or if there is interference with the transmission. Charging the battery and verifying for any interference can often correct these issues.
